Chris Carpenter allowed two runs on six hits and struck out four over seven innings in the Cardinals 4-2 loss to the Rangers in Game 5 of the World Series.
Carpenter looked to be in control for most of the game, featuring his curveball and retiring Josh Hamilton and Michael Young to start the sixth before giving up a game-tying solo home run to Adrian Beltre that ultimately sparked the Rangers comeback. The Cardinals had a chance to get back in front in the seventh when reliever Alexi Ogando walked three and gave up a single, but Allen Craig was thrown out on a busted hit and run and David Freese flied out to center with the bases loaded. St. Louis will now be forced to battle back from a 3-2 deficit behind starter Jaime Garcia in Game 6 and possibly Kyle Lohse in Game 7.
